General Purpose Laboratory & Field Redox Sensor

Description Epoxy body combination Redox sensor, with screw-on membrane guard. The Porous Teflon reference system makes this sensor suitable for most water samples, excluding Slurries, Soil Suspensions and other solutions that can clog reference junctions.
Range -2000 to +2000 mV
Temperature Range 0 to 60 OC (32 to 140 OF)
Sensing Electrode Platinum
Reference System Ag/AgCl, double junction with Porous Teflon junction.
Dimensions 120 x 12 mm

Intermediate Junction Redox Sensor

Description Epoxy body combination Redox sensor, with unique Intermediate Junction reference design. The sleeve at the end of the sensor can be removed for cleaning. Suitable for difficult samples such as slurries that could block other reference junctions.  Two sleeves are provided - one with protective forks (as shown), and a narrow sleeve.
Range -2000 to +2000 mV
Temperature Range 0 to 60 OC (32 to 140 OF)
Sensing Electrode Platinum
Reference System Ag/AgCl, with Intermediate Junction reference.
Dimensions 120 x 12 mm (diameter of spear sleeve is 8mm)

Intermediate Junction Silver Billet Sensor

Description Silver electrode, commonly used for Silver Nitrate titrations for determining Chloride content in dairy products. Epoxy body combination sensor, with unique Intermediate Junction reference design. The sleeve at the end of the sensor can be removed for cleaning. The Intermediate Junction reference resists clogging by fatty or oily products.

Not recommended as a Silver Ion Selective electrode.

Range -2000 to +2000 mV
Temperature Range 0 to 60 OC (32 to 140 OF)
Sensing Electrode Silver
Reference System Ag/AgCl, with Intermediate Junction reference.
Dimensions 120 x 12 mm (diameter of spear sleeve is 8mm)

Double Platinum Sensor for Karl Fischer Titrations

Description Glass body sensor with two pure platinum plates. Normally used as the sensing electrode for the Karl Fischer titration method for moisture measurement.
Temperature Range 0 to 80 OC (32 to 176 OF)
Dimensions 120 x 12 mm
